Leadership Review Briefing: Customer Concentration

Kestrel Analytics now represents 41% of annual recurring revenue, up from 28% last year. Their contract renews in ten months, and any repricing would materially affect forecasts. Finance should model scenarios at 60%, 80%, and full renewal value.

Mitigation options will be discussed at the review, starting with the note below.

board note of bagug-kafof: The steering committee signed off on a budget of $55.0 million for Project Fraox. The renewal with Fenvanek Freight closes at $37.0 million a year, 4 percent above the last contract.

## Getting the Audio Guide Running Locally

Hey folks—quick setup for the Murmurstone guide app. Pull the repo, run `./bootstrap.sh`, and grab the sample exhibit pack with `make fixtures`. Audio streams from the local asset server on port 5080, so start that first or the tour screen just spins. The exhibit metadata service needs a database to talk to, and it picks up the connection from the line below.

primary connection of kahof-kagep = mssql://belath_svc:3uqY4g6LHG5Nyi@db-d0ba.ferralabs.corp:5432/rusdor

## Weather-Alert Fan-Out

Stormrelay fans out alerts to registered plugin endpoints in priority order. Plugins must ack within 2 seconds or the alert is requeued; three failures trigger quarantine. Do not retry quarantined endpoints manually. Payload schema, ack semantics, and quarantine release procedure are documented on the internal page below.

wiki page, yaguf-bawig: https://jira.norvacorp.internal/browse/display/view/b5a061abb09d

FACILITIES TICKET — Korvath Tower, Level 9 opening. Night shift: new floor goes live 05:00 Monday. HVAC commissioned, fire panel armed, lifts unlocked to L9. Do NOT prop stairwell doors; alarms are live. Cleaning crew from Bravenhall Services arrives 03:30 — escort required until turnstiles activate. Check that the east wing motion sensors log correctly and report any faults to the duty engineer before 04:00. The L9 service corridor stays locked; night staff use the temporary pass below.

door code, yagap-bahof: bdg-O-05